Do Motorcycle Cops Have Radar? 

It’s too common for riders to get a speeding ticket for the cops on a motorbike, but now the question arises, do motorcycle cops have radar? 

Motorcycle cops have radar with them. Through them, they catch riders riding beyond the certain speed limit. But because of limited space on motorbikes, they have to carry radar guns in their hands to check the speed of motorbikes.

Do Motorcycle Cops also Use Cameras? 

So far, you understand that cops do have radar while patrolling, but have you seen a small on their helmet and wondered what it’s all about? 

Usually, motorbike cops carry a small camera mounted on their helmets, which helps them settle disputes regarding traffic lights, seat belts, and mobile phones while driving. 

In some cases, cops also use cameras to prove to the rider that they are breaking the law while riding.

However, the camera doesn’t help the cops measure the speed of the vehicle just by passing by, and they use radar to know the motorbike’s speed. 

Do Motorcycle Cops Have to Show You Radar? 

So far, you understand some problems with the radar of motorbike cops. Now the question arises, do motorcycle cops have to show you radar? 

Motorcycle cops don’t have to show you the radar reading of your speeding motorcycle, it’s not a legal requirement, but it’s a privilege for cops to show you a reading. 

You can even request the officer to show you the reading of your vehicle; through this, you can know if the reading is inaccurate.

Can You Block Cops Radar? 

Finally, you understand some problems with cops’ radars, but how will you detect the cops’ radars if they’re working fine? 

You can detect the cops’ radar by the radar detector; with the radar detector, you can know what the cops have or not and if they’re in an inactive condition or not. 

However, using radar detectors to detect cops in many countries is a punishable offense. Before installing any radar detector, I recommend reading and following only your local laws.
